                        "*": "===Definition===\nAn [[arrhythmia]] caused by a second connection between atria and ventricles, in addition to the [[Heart#Function|normal conduction system]]. There are two types:\n*'''AVRNT''' (Atrio-Ventricular Node Re-entry Tachycardia) - the second connection is closely related to the AV node.\n*'''AVRT''' (Atrio-Ventricular Re-entry Tachycardia) - the second connection is not related to the AV node.\n\n===Clinical Features===\n*[[Palpitations]]\n*[[Syncope]]/presyncope\n*[[Chest pain]] and polyuria. \nSymptoms can be associated with exertion\n\n===ECG findings===\nRate of 130-250. Narrow '''QRS''' complex (except in [[bundle branch block]]), P waves are: inverted, masked by QRS complex ([[#Definition|AVNRT]]) or occur halfway between complexes ([[#Definition|AVRT]]), one P wave per QRS complex.\n\n===Management===\n*'''Drugs''' - adenosine or verapamil. (Flecanide, sotalol, dispyramide are other options).\n*'''Electrical''' - [[pacing]] and [[cardioversion]] as above.\n*'''Vagal''' - carotid sinus massage, pressure on closed eyes, application of ice to face.\n*'''Ablation''' - burning away the dodgy bit of conduction pathway."

                        "*": "Autoimmune attack on joint following an unrelated infection\n\nReiter's syndrome (a kind of reactive arthritis) - \"The patient can't see, can't pee and can't bend the knee\" or \"the patient can't see, can't pee and can't climb a tree\" ([[conjunctivitis]]/[[uveitis]], [[urethritis]] and [[joint pain]])."
